5-(4-pyridyl)-1,3,4-oxadiazole-2-thiol

Description:
5-(4-pyridyl)-1,3,4-oxadiazole-2-thiol is a heterocyclic compound characterized by the presence of a pyridine ring and an oxadiazole moiety, which contributes to its unique chemical properties. This compound features a thiol (-SH) functional group, enhancing its reactivity and potential for forming metal complexes. It is typically a solid at room temperature and may exhibit moderate solubility in polar organic solvents. The presence of the pyridyl group can impart basicity, while the oxadiazole structure may contribute to its stability and potential for engaging in various chemical reactions, such as nucleophilic substitutions or coordination with metal ions. This compound is of interest in various fields, including medicinal chemistry and materials science, due to its potential biological activity and ability to act as a ligand in coordination chemistry. Its properties can be influenced by factors such as pH, solvent, and temperature, making it a versatile compound for research and application in diverse chemical contexts.
Formula:C7H5N3OS
InChI:InChI=1/C7H5N3OS/c12-7-10-9-6(11-7)5-1-3-8-4-2-5/h1-4H,(H,10,12)
SMILES:c1cnccc1c1nnc(o1)S
